The Beauty of the Basket Weave: A Timeless Icing Technique
The basket weave pattern, a classic in cake decorating, mimics the look of woven baskets. It’s achieved by carefully piping icing strips to create a criss-crossed design. This technique adds a touch of texture and elegance to any cake, making it perfect for birthdays, weddings, or even a simple afternoon tea. Choosing the Right Flowers for Your Flower Topped Basket Weave Cake
Not all flowers are suitable for cake decoration. Some are toxic, while others have strong scents that can overpower the cake’s flavor. Opt for edible flowers like pansies, violas, roses, and nasturtiums. Always wash them thoroughly and ensure they’re pesticide-free. Alternatively, you can use non-edible flowers, but make sure they are placed on a small piece of parchment paper or in individual flower picks to prevent direct contact with the cake.
Mastering the Basket Weave Technique: A Step-by-Step Guide
Creating a basket weave pattern might seem daunting, but it’s surprisingly simple with practice.
- Prepare your icing: Ensure your buttercream is the right consistency – not too thick, not too runny.
- Pipe vertical lines: Pipe even, vertical lines of icing onto your frosted cake.
- Pipe horizontal lines: Pipe horizontal lines over the vertical ones, creating the woven effect.
- Repeat: Continue alternating vertical and horizontal lines until the entire cake is covered.

What frosting is best for a basket weave cake?
Buttercream is the most popular choice for basket weave cakes due to its smooth texture and ability to hold its shape well.
How can I make my basket weave icing look neater?
Practice makes perfect! Start with a small practice cake to get the hang of the piping technique. Using a piping bag with a flat tip and ensuring consistent pressure will also help achieve a cleaner look.

FAQs
- Can I use artificial flowers on my cake? Yes, but ensure they’re food-safe and don’t come into direct contact with the edible parts of the cake.
- What type of icing tip is best for basket weave? A large flat tip, such as a Wilton 1A or 2D, is ideal for creating the clean lines needed for the basket weave pattern.
- Can I freeze a basket weave cake? Yes, you can freeze the unfrosted cake layers or even the fully decorated cake (without the fresh flowers).
- How far in advance can I make a basket weave cake? The cake layers can be baked a few days ahead, but the icing and flower decorations are best done the day of or the day before the event.
- What are some alternative decorations for a basket weave cake? Besides flowers, you can use fruits, berries, chocolate shavings, or sprinkles to decorate your basket weave cake.
- Can I use a different icing technique with fresh flowers? Absolutely! Fresh flowers can enhance any cake design.
- Where can I find edible flowers? Check with local specialty grocery stores, farmers markets, or online retailers specializing in edible flowers.
